That person could be you. 🩺 Job Description (SNF Nursing) As a Skilled Nursing Facility (SNF) nurse, you will provide comprehensive care for geriatric residents who require 24/7 support. Duties include: Ordering medications, equipment, and supplies as prescribed Preparing and administering treatments and medications Communicating changes in condition to physicians and family members Performing skilled nursing services such as tube feedings, suctioning, catheterization, wound care, dressings, and irrigations Continuous monitoring of critically ill residents Acting as a resident advocate and ensuring care aligns with the care plan and personal wishes Completing accurate, timely charting and documentation. 📋 Requirements Active RN or LPN license in good standing Strong communication skills with residents, families, staff, and visitors Ability to make sound, independent decisions Solid knowledge of nursing best practices and medical procedures Understanding of state, federal, and local regulations for long-term care If you're ready to join a team that values you, supports you, and gives you the opportunity to make a meaningful impact, apply today!
